  • Riverway House (162 Riverway) at BU

    Rated 4.4 / 5 stars by 4 BU students

    "One of the cleanest and most modern dorms on campus. Building is really nice. No communal bathrooms and AC in each room. Fenway dining hall is really good. Get ready for a 15 minute walk to class though. The Fenway bus is spotty."

  • Myles Standish Hall at BU

    Rated 4.5 / 5 stars by 32 BU students

    "This is one of the most spacious dorms eve at BU! What used to be the oldest dorm on campus, was finally remodeled and has a brand new hotel feeling while not compromising the size of the rooms! It now has communal downstairs kitchen, and is very close walk to Questrom School of Business! Not to mention, Babe Ruth stayed at Myles Hotel back when he played for the Red Sox!"

  • StuVi1 (10 Buick St) at BU

    Rated 4.6 / 5 stars by 18 BU students

    "Pros: large living rooms, single bedrooms, split bathroom with only one other roommate, and full kitchens. Cons: not all apartments are the same (some have smaller kitchens/living rooms), maintenance is not always on top of things (had to wait weeks to get oven replaced), building layout and study spaces are very nice but could use small renovations to keep it up to date (for the price it ought to be pristine). Location can be good or bad depending on the resident's situation."
